City-Centre - Petite France

Petite France charms visitors with its picturesque medieval landscape where half-timbered buildings lean over winding canals. Wooden shutters and flower boxes adorn colourful facades dating back centuries. The neighborhood's cobblestone streets and stone bridges create a storybook setting. Covered walkways offer stunning views of this UNESCO World Heritage gem. Strasbourg Cathedral's spire rises above this historic district where tram stops provide easy access to the city centre. Wander through pedestrian-only zones to discover local artisan shops selling Alsatian crafts. Traditional winstubs serve regional specialities alongside canal views. Early mornings offer the most authentic experience before tour groups arrive.

Krutenau

The medieval charm of Krutenau blends with bohemian energy in this historic Strasbourg area. Students from nearby universities fill cafés and affordable bistros along narrow cobblestone streets. Art galleries occupy converted workshops while half-timbered buildings house boutique shops. Discover cultural treasures at the Alsatian Museum or stroll along the Ill River's peaceful paths. The neighborhood's two tram stations make exploring Strasbourg's famous cathedral and other landmarks incredibly convenient. History buffs and creative souls alike find their perfect match in Krutenau's authentic atmosphere.

Neudorf Ouest

Neudorf Ouest offers a peaceful escape from Strasbourg's tourist crowds. This residential area gives travellers an authentic glimpse into local French life. Three convenient tram stations connect you to the city centre in just 10-15 minutes. The area features charming tree-lined streets perfect for quiet evening strolls. Budget-conscious travellers will appreciate the affordable accommodation and locally-priced cafés serving traditional Alsatian dishes. Visit the nearby Rivetoile Shopping Centre or hop on a tram to explore Strasbourg's historic attractions.

Best time to go to Strasbourg

The best time to visit Strasbourg can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Strasbourg fal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Strasbourg fal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What's the seasonal weather like in Strasbourg?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 4°C. Average annual precipitation for Strasbourg is 927 mm.
